项目摘要
The objectives of this proposed work are three-fold: 1. To corroborate in a
larger prospective study our presently completed feasibility study in 45
patients. This study illustrates that dexamethasone suppression adrenal
scintiscanning with radioiodinated cholesterol reveals 4 anatomical-functional
imaging patterns in patients with low renin essential hypertension: 1. Uptake
of I-131 in one adrenal only is found in an adenoma of one adrenal cortex. 2.
Symmetrical uptake early and late is found in macronodular hyperplasia of the
adrenal cortex. 3. Symmetrical uptake four days or more after tracer
administration is found in micronodular hyperplasia. 4. No uptake in either
adrenal early or late is found when the adrenal cortices are normal. Blood
pressure falls to normal during the administration of spironolactone when the
adrenal cortex is abnormal as recognized by scintiscanning but does not respond
significantly to spironolactone when the adrenal cortex is normal. 2. To
synthesize, develop and evaluate radiolabeled inhibitors of enzymes in adrenal
glands would decrease the time required for imaging and the radiation dose in
comparison to the currently used radioiodinated cholesterols. 3. To synthesize,
develop and evaluate the anatomical-functional imaging capabilities of
radiolabeled neuronal blocking agents, and reversible inhibitors of enzymes in
the adrenal medulla. The diagnostic capabilities of the most successful of
these radiolabeled imaging agents will be analyzed first in patients most at
risk for disease of the adrenal medulla, then in patients with normal and high
renin hypertension.
